When we covered Prusa’s INDX toolchanger shipping in volume earlier this month, it was still an add-on: something you bolted onto a CORE One or CORE One+ you already owned. Buying a fresh printer and paying separately for the kit was the only route in. That changed on August 20, and on August 27 the bigger CORE One L+ joined the lineup too.
A complete printer, not just a kit
Prusa now sells the CORE One+ (Gen 2) with Bondtech INDX pre-installed in four configurations: assembled or as a kit, with 4 or 8 tools. The assembled versions arrive built, calibrated and tested at the factory, which matters more here than it would on a single-nozzle printer, since INDX means aligning up to eight separate toolheads. Prusa’s own product pages list the assembled 4-tool machine at $1,999 and the 8-tool version at $2,249, with shipments starting in mid-October.
For comparison, the INDX conversion kit alone costs $693.52 for 4 tools on top of a printer you already own. The new complete-printer pricing is not cheap, but it removes a step: no ordering a CORE One+ Gen 2, waiting for it to arrive, then ordering the kit separately and spending 5 to 6 hours installing it yourself.
The CORE One L+ finally gets INDX
The larger CORE One L+, with its 27-liter build volume and 60°C chamber, was the obvious gap. Our last INDX update noted that Prusa was still working on an L+ version with no date attached. That gap closed on August 27, when Prusa opened orders for both a CORE One L+ INDX conversion kit and a complete, factory-assembled CORE One L+ INDX printer.
The assembled 8-tool CORE One L+ INDX lists at $2,767.60 on Prusa’s site, shipping starting November 5. Build volume with the toolchanger installed comes to 298 x 275 x 330mm, slightly smaller than the standard CORE One L+ to make room for the tool dock. The rest carries over from the hardware refresh Prusa shipped in mid-August: GT1.5 belts and the nozzle wiper are already built in.
One caveat worth knowing: the nozzles
Prusa published a detail worth passing along instead of glossing over. The nozzles shipping with INDX are surface-hardened, not fully hardened the way Bondtech originally specified. Prusa ran extended wear tests after the fact and says the results came back better than its early accelerated testing suggested, but the practical limits are real: roughly 10kg of PETG-CF, 5kg of PC-CF, or 0.5kg of abrasive Ultraglow filament per nozzle before print quality starts to suffer. Regular materials, PLA, PETG, ABS, ASA, TPU, Nylon and the rest, are not affected. If your plan for an 8-tool INDX involves running mostly carbon-fiber filament through it, budget for nozzle replacements sooner than the spec sheet implies.
Ship dates are still moving
Worth flagging for anyone about to order: comments on Prusa’s own announcement post show batch numbers shifting after the fact, including at least one buyer whose order moved from an initial Batch 1 placeholder to batch 6 or 7 with no warning. Prusa says the mix-up came from using Batch 1 as a default label before real calculations were done, and that it will use clearer placeholder names going forward. If you order now, treat mid-October and November 5 as starting points rather than guarantees.
